I. The Role and Significance of Third-Party Valve Inspection Agencies
The core function of third-party valve inspection agencies is to conduct comprehensive quality testing and evaluation of valve products. These inspections extend beyond visual examinations of valve appearance to encompass testing of multiple aspects including valve structure, material composition, sealing integrity, corrosion resistance, pressure strength, and high-temperature performance. Through these rigorous tests, a thorough understanding of valve product quality levels is achieved, ensuring compliance with relevant national standards and industry regulations.

Third-party valve inspection agencies can help enterprises mitigate production risks. As valves become increasingly prevalent across multiple industries, the safety hazards posed by valve failures also grow. Design flaws or quality issues in valves may trigger production accidents or cause equipment shutdowns, resulting in significant economic losses. Through third-party inspections, potential problems can be identified early, preventing accidents and safeguarding production safety for enterprises.

II. Considerations for Selecting a Third-Party Testing Agency for Valves

1. Qualification Certification and Industry Experience
A professional third-party testing organization must possess relevant accreditation certifications, such as ISO 17025 laboratory accreditation. An accredited testing organization signifies that it has attained nationally and internationally recognized testing capabilities and technical proficiency, enabling it to provide reliable and impartial testing services. Selecting a testing organization with extensive industry experience ensures a deep understanding of valve product characteristics and industry standards, resulting in more professional testing reports.

III. Service Process of Third-Party Valve Inspection Agencies

1. Requirements Communication and Solution Development
Prior to the commencement of testing, enterprises must provide the testing agency with detailed valve product information. Based on this information, the testing agency develops a corresponding testing plan. This plan includes specific testing items, methods, standards, and cycles. Through thorough communication, both parties ensure a shared understanding of the testing objectives and standards.
2. Product Submission for Testing and Sample Preparation
According to the testing plan, the enterprise submits valve samples requiring inspection to the testing agency. At this stage, the enterprise must ensure the integrity of the samples to prevent damage during transportation. The testing agency will conduct a preliminary inspection of the samples to confirm they meet the testing requirements.
3. Actual Testing and Data Analysis
Technical personnel at testing institutions conduct multiple tests on valve products using advanced testing equipment in accordance with relevant standards and specifications. These tests may include mechanical performance testing, corrosion resistance testing, sealing performance testing, high-temperature resistance testing, and others. During the testing process, the testing institution analyzes the product's various performance characteristics based on the test data to ensure compliance with quality standards.
4. Issuance of Test Reports
Upon completion of testing, the inspection agency will issue a detailed inspection report based on the test results. This report includes all test metrics, testing methods, test results, and the final evaluation conclusion. Companies can use this report to understand the quality status of their valve products and implement corresponding quality control measures or improvements based on the report's findings.
